Q: Is 124,409 a Prime Number?

 A: No, 124,409 is not a prime number.

Why is 124,409 not a prime number?

A prime number is a natural number, greater than one, that can only be divided by 1 and itself.

The number 124409 can be evenly divided by 1 47 2,647 and 124,409, with no remainder.

Since 124,409 cannot be divided by just 1 and 124,409, it is not a prime number.
